Cargo Door Beauty Panel Re-Attachment

Removed the Cargo Door Beauty Panel for repair (due to RV Parking damage) Which is a smaller 36"x24" Door size.
Door Beauty panel was attached with (2) Adhesives to approximately 1" - width 4 sided aluminum frame.
Now I am unable to locate any product, that had been used to attach the beauty panel to the aluminum frame. No bolts, etc were used to attach the two panels.

See photo BEFORE REMOVING FROM RV

Two types of Adhesives were used.
- 2 Part Glue Epoxy ( caulk type ) used on inside of 1" wide INNER edge of Aluminum frame.
- 2 nd Adhesive was Double Sided Adhesive tape on same 1" OUTER edge of the same Aluminum frame.

Interesting that 2 were used at same original install date.
Called Damon now Thor of course, they said call #3m.
Around and Around I go

Talked to 3m and they say no adhesive of there hundreds would hold with out using a hard fixed attachment fastener along with any 3m adhesive.
Any ideas as to what we may use to attach the Beauty Door Skin to Aluminum Frame ? So IF AND HOPEFULLY NEVER again i can separate the doors again for more repair. ?
Im afraid to use todays 2 part epoxy since getting them apart would be a real mess.

I had one bay door skin separate from the frame. Your photo could have been taken of mine, same construction.

At someone else's suggestion I used JB Weld to glue the skin back to the frame. It's been almost a year now, still holding strong.

3m does make a very strong bonding tape...
i had one start the peel, so i installed a through bolt and nut from outside to teh inner side and then got some paint matched and painted the bolt heads, you cant see em unless you know to look
i believe the tape is VHB
